1 CROSS WAY is a very small detached house of 76m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966. It was last sold for £480,000 in October 2024, which was around 19% below the average October 2024 detached price in the Lewes local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was June 2024,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

1 CROSS WAY Sold Prices

Land registry data shows three sales for 1 CROSS WAY since 1st January 1995. The below table shows the price paid for the three sales, along with the average detached price in the Lewes local authority area for the corresponding sale date. All of the three 1 CROSS WAY sales were for below the average price. The average price is sourced from the Office for National Statistics' House Price Index (HPI).

How Large is 1 CROSS WAY?

1 CROSS WAY is 76m² according to the EPC inspection conducted in June 2024. This puts it in the smallest 10% of detached houses in Lewes,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of detached houses by size in Lewes, and where 1 CROSS WAY lies on this distribution: 6% of detached houses are smaller than 1 CROSS WAY, and 94%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Lewes.
